Engine Options and Performance

The Ford F-150 stands out for its diverse engine lineup, allowing buyers to choose an option that best suits their driving needs. The engines range from a fuel-efficient 2.7-liter EcoBoost to a powerful 5.0-liter V8, each offering unique benefits. The EcoBoost engines are particularly renowned for their balance of power and efficiency, providing a smooth driving experience with impressive towing capabilities.

For those prioritizing fuel economy without compromising on performance, the hybrid option is a notable choice. It combines a 3.5-liter PowerBoost engine with electric power, delivering exceptional torque and towing capacity. This variety ensures that whether you’re looking for a daily driver or a workhorse, the F-150 has an engine that will meet your expectations.

Advanced Technology Features

Modern vehicles are expected to offer advanced technological features, and the Ford F-150 does not disappoint. It integrates a range of cutting-edge technologies designed to enhance safety, connectivity, and convenience. The SYNC 4 infotainment system, for instance, provides seamless smartphone integration, navigation, and voice-activated controls, making it easier for drivers to stay connected on the go.

Safety is another area where the F-150 excels. It comes equipped with Ford Co-Pilot360, a suite of driver-assist technologies that include features like ad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and pre-collision assist with automatic emergency braking. These technologies work together to provide peace of mind, ensuring that drivers and passengers are well-protected on every journey.

Towing and Payload Capabilities

The Ford F-150 is designed with towing and payload capabilities that make it a strong contender for those needing a truck that can handle heavy-duty tasks. With a maximum towing capacity exceeding 14,000 pounds, the F-150 is well-suited for hauling trailers, boats, and other large items. Its payload capacity is equally impressive, allowing for the transportation of heavy loads in the truck bed.

These capabilities are supported by features like Pro Trailer Backup Assist, which simplifies the process of maneuvering trailers, and the Smart Trailer Tow Connector, which provides real-time information on trailer status. Such innovations make the F-150 not just a powerful vehicle, but also one that is user-friendly and efficient for towing tasks.
